DPG Degree College offers courses in UG, PG and Diploma level across the streams of Accounting & Commerce, Hospitality & Travel, IT & Software, Science, Teaching & Education, among others. Admission to all the courses is based on merit and requires candidates to secure a minimum aggregate in Class 12 and graduation. Studying at DPG Degree College is not free. The college offers courses with a tuition fees ranging from INR 31K to INR 3.56 Lakh. However, DPG Degree College offers relaxation through various scholarship schemes offered on the basis of the results attained during the period of semester examination.
Kurukshetra University (KUK) has a Centre for Distance and Online Education available for students. The online courses are approved by AICTE, UGC, and accredited with A+ Grade by NAAC. Some of the online programmes available are below:
PG Programmes
- Online MA
- Online MBA
- Online MBA Plus
- Online MCA
UG Programmes
- Online BBA
Online BCom
Online BA
Yes, Pt. Jawahar Lal Nehru Government College is a Public/ Government College. Pt. Jawahar Lal Nehru Government College, Faridabad was established in 1971. The college is spread across 12.5 acre of land. Being a centre of IGNOU, New Delhi, the college is an important hub of distance education as well. The college gives UG, PG, and other programmes to students.
